Blue and Gold Dinner 2019 is the Pack Meeting for February and will be held on Saturday, February 16th from 5 - 8PM. This year's theme is "Scouts are TOTALLY RAD." It's held annually to celebrate our Pack's anniversary, to bring families together for fun and cheer, to thank pack leaders and adults, and to recognize our scouts accomplishments. We'll have food, fun activities and games, awards, the Cake Contest, and each den will show their skills at decorating their own tables too! We look forward to celebrating with each of you!

What is the Cake Bake and what are the rules for the contest?
In this great tradition, scouts will bake a cake with dad, grandpa, or another adult. In the spirit of scouting, the scout is asked to do the majority of the baking and decorating with supervision. It's a fun project and will serve as the dessert for the event. Cakes will be judged on appearance in the following categories:
- Most Scout Like
- Funny
- 80's themed
Cake Info and Instructions:
- Cakes can be no larger than 9”x13” rectangle or 9” round to accommodate for all entries
- Cakes can be made at home or from a store, but must be decorated by the scout and an adult partner
- Cakes must be completely edible to be entered into the contest per BSA guidelines
- Cakes are to be delivered to FUMC Gym between 4:25 - 4:30 PM on the day of the event
- Make sure to sign in (at event) to get credit for the cake baking and place your cake on the correct table based on your category
